Egyptian President Abdel Fattah El Sisi asserted that Egypt backs the Chinese initiative for reviving the historical Silk Road, saying Cairo is fully ready for cooperation in this respect as soon as possible.
Sisi's remarks were made at the start of his official talks with his Chinese counterpart Xi Jinping at China's Great Hall of the People.
Sisi said this road has been a historical route for China's trade to the world and Egypt has been a cornerstone of the Chinese traders' trips to various world countries.
He said this initiative coincides with Egypt's launching of the Suez Canal Corridor that will further push forward international trade movement.
